With a variety of subjects such as Math, Physics, Biology, Social Sciences, Humanities, Business and more, OpenStax boasts one of the most comprehensive collections available online most of which is completely free. The site is used by almost 4, schools across the U.
As the demand for more subjects increases, OpenStax continues to diversify their library. They will soon be expanding into computer and data sciences, nursing and liberal arts textbooks.

Alina Bradford. Used textbooks can be even better than new. Here are 11 ways to get free or discounted textbooks: The first place to look for free text books is your university's library.
Most libraries carry textbooks or they can get you the textbook you're looking for from another library through the interlibrary system. The trick is you need to get to your school's library as soon as possible before other students scoop up all the free books. Project Gutenberg has over 43, free ebooks. You may be able to find most of your required reading list here.
